The upper card slot accepts: ■ CompactFlash™ type I media ■ CompactFlash type II media ■ IBM Microdrive disk drive The lower card slot accepts: ■ Secure Digital (SD) Memory Card ■ MultiMediaCard (MMC) ■ Memory Stick® (MS) Memory Card ■ SmartMedia™ (SM) Memory Card Special note about the Safely Remove Hardware Utility Warning: Do not click Stop in the Safely Remove Hardware window with the USB Mass Storage Device selected. Doing so removes the operating system recognition of the 6-In-1 memory card reader from your PC; you must restart the PC to see your reader again. If you open the Safely Remove Hardware window by mistake, click Close. To use the 6-In-1 memory card reader Important: CompactFlash and Microdrive are keyed and cannot be inserted incorrectly. Insert the receptacle edge (holes) of this media into the upper slot. The Secure Digital (SD) card, the MultiMediaCard (MMC), and the Memory Stick (MS) card must be inserted upside down (gold connector fingers face up). Note the direction of the notched corner on the media. 1 Insert the media into the card slot until it stops. The in-use light (A) on the card reader lights, and the PC automatically detects the media. 2 The PC opens a window so you can access the media contents. You can copy files from or to the media.
